Buildforce Solutions are recruiting for a Site Administrator to join a leading main contractor delivering a secure Ministry of Justice (MOJ) project. This is an excellent opportunity to join a well-established business on a high-profile scheme, providing essential administrative support to the site team while working in a secure environment.
The Role
Working closely with the Project Manager and wider site team, you will be responsible for ensuring all project administration is managed efficiently and accurately. Key responsibilities include:
- Providing general administrative support to the project team
- Organising meetings, issuing invitations and managing diaries
- Attending meetings, taking minutes and distributing action logs
- Managing digital filing systems and document control
- Printing, collating and issuing project documentation
- Preparing information packs and project folders as required
- Updating and maintaining project trackers and registers
- Liaising with subcontractors and suppliers via phone and email
- Chasing outstanding information and maintaining accurate project records
- Supporting the team with a range of day-to-day administrative duties
